WHO WILL PAY MY MEDICAL BILLS?
If you were working at the time of the injury, you will likely file a workers’ compensation claim. One of the several benefits from a workers compensation claim is the right to medical benefits. That means your employer’s workers’ compensation carrier is responsible to pay your medical bills that are reasonably causally related to the injury. If you also bring a negligence claim against a different defendant, then that defendant might also be liable for the medical bills. Of course, in the end, when the case is finally concluded, then the responsible defendant, or their insurance company, will be responsible for the medical bills.
IF I CAN’T WORK, WHO WILL PAY MY LOST WAGES?
If you can’t work then you will not receive any wages. You can sue the defendant for those lost wages, past and future.
Additionally, if you have filed a workers’ compensation claim, you are entitled to workers compensation benefits when y0u cannot work.
Of course, if you are covered by your employer’s short term disability policy, then you can receive those benefits.
Your lost wages will be part of the damages you will claim in your personal injury lawsuit. In the event you receive short term disability benefits, or workers’ compensation, then those companies might have to be reimbursed.

IS THERE A TIME LIMIT WITHIN WHICH I CAN SUE, OR STATUTE OF LIMITATIONS?
There are definitely time limits within which you must file sue. For a car or truck vs. pedestrian accident in Connecticut, the statute of limitations is two years from the date of the accident. For certain types of claims, the statute of limitations might be shorter. Therefore, it is crucial for you to consult with a Connecticut injury lawyer to confirm the applicable statute of limitations for your case.
If you fail to file suit within the statute of limitations, you will completely lose your rights to sue.

WHO DOES THE INSURANCE COMPANY REPRESENT?
The insurance adjuster for the defendant does not represent you. They do not owe you a duty of reasonableness, or even truthfulness. Their job is to pay you as little as possible.
SHOULD I SPEAK WITH THE INSURANCE ADJUSTER?
You should not speak with the defendant’s insurance representative unless you have previously consulted with your lawyer for legal advice. Only your lawyer owes you a fiduciary duty.
